The document compares negotiation, mediation, and conciliation, highlighting their differences in third-party involvement, legal frameworks, and control over processes and outcomes. Mediation involves a neutral facilitator, while conciliation includes a conciliator who can suggest solutions, and both are governed by specific legal acts. The document also outlines aspects such as confidentiality, costs, and the ability to use outcomes in court or arbitration.
